I dont' know because I just configured it myself, but I think I read somewhere around post number 34 or 35, that Sprint needs an outgoing port setting of 465? Check back there as I am sure that someone said sprint required a different outgoing port number, but I can't remember it now . . .

The other thing is that you will have to access gMail and change your settings for POP access.
Once you change the settings there, I think you should be good to go . .


Originally Posted by Barney Fife
Hi guys -

I followed all the screen shots and here is the error message I received:

-ERR(SYS/PERM) Your account is not enabled for POP access. Please visit your Gmail settings and enable your account for POP access.

I double-checked what I loaded, and I definitely followed the procedure except for one small item. The Outgoing Server Setting came up with the default Port 25. I left it alone, and I got this error message above. I changed it to port 587 and received the same error message. Where did I go wrong?

I'm using Sprint.

Thanks for the assistance.
